Role Overview:
We are in search of a Chief Financial Officer (CFO) who is not only strategic and experienced but also driven by a commitment to fiscal excellence and high-quality healthcare delivery. As a key member of our executive team, the CFO will guide our financial strategy and operations, ensuring our organization's sustainability and growth, while upholding the highest standards of care and service.

Responsibilities:
Develop and implement robust financial strategies aligned with our mission.
Manage all financial operations, including budgeting, forecasting, and financial reporting.
Analyze financial data to identify trends, perform risk assessment, and recommend effective solutions.
Ensure optimal cash flow management and oversee investment strategies.
Work collaboratively with other executive leaders to enhance operational effectiveness and patient care.
Uphold rigorous compliance with financial regulations and best practices.
Lead, mentor, and expand the capabilities of the finance team to ensure peak performance.
Act as a financial advisor to the CEO and Board of Directors, contributing to strategic planning and decision-making.
Required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, or a related field; advanced credentials such as an MBA or CPA are preferred.
Extensive experience in a senior financial role, ideally within healthcare or nonprofit sectors, with a focus on addiction treatment.
Strong analytical skills and financial acumen to drive data-driven decisions.
Proven leadership ability with a track record of developing high-performing teams.
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ills, adept at engaging with various stakeholders.
Comprehensive understanding of healthcare finance, including reimbursement models and regulatory frameworks.
Deep commitment to enhancing the quality of life for individuals through superior addiction treatment services.
